Is Hidden Valley Ranch Halal?
MUSHBOOH
It contains disodium inosinate and guanylate, ribonucleotide flavour enhancers whose source is usually yeast or sardines but can rarely involve pork; a halal mark would settle it.
Hanafi — their opinion: the processing transforms the substance, so it is allowed.
Shafi, Maliki, Jafari, Zaydi, Hanbali, Ibadi — their opinion: the source is rarely named, so it should be avoided.
Follow your own scholar.
